Police investigate Brunswick East assault

A man has been arrested following an alleged assault of a pedestrian at a Brunswick East tram stop on Monday, Victoria Police say.

It is believed a physical altercation broke out between a tram commuter and the driver of a silver Hyundai van about 2.15pm on 27 November at tram stop 127, located at Holmes and Albion streets.

The pedestrian, a 55-year-old Brunswick man, sustained facial injuries and was taken to hospital.

It is alleged the driver then took off.

Police later arrested a 33-year-old South Morang man, who has been released pending summons.
